Hi,

during a test with piuparts I noticed your package fails to upgrade from
'jessie'.
It installed fine in 'jessie', then the upgrade to 'stretch' fails.

>From the attached log (scroll to the bottom...):

  Setting up openstack-dashboard (2:9.0.0-2) ...
  WARNING:root:"dashboards" and "default_dashboard" in (local_)settings is 
DEPRECATED now and may be unsupported in some future release. The preferred way 
to specify the order of dashboards and the default dashboard is the pluggable 
dashboard mechanism (in 
/usr/share/openstack-dashboard/openstack_dashboard/enabled, 
/usr/share/openstack-dashboard/openstack_dashboard/local/enabled).
  Traceback (most recent call last):
    File "/usr/share/openstack-dashboard/manage.py", line 25, in <module>
      execute_from_command_line(sys.argv)
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/django/core/management/__init__.py", 
line 353, in execute_from_command_line
      utility.execute()
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/django/core/management/__init__.py", 
line 327, in execute
      django.setup()
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/django/__init__.py", line 17, in 
setup
      configure_logging(settings.LOGGING_CONFIG, settings.LOGGING)
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/django/utils/log.py", line 71, in 
configure_logging
      logging_config_func(logging_settings)
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/logging/config.py", line 794, in dictConfig
      dictConfigClass(config).configure()
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/logging/config.py", line 576, in configure
      '%r: %s' % (name, e))
  ValueError: Unable to configure handler 'null': Cannot resolve 
'django.utils.log.NullHandler': No module named NullHandler
  dpkg: error processing package openstack-dashboard (--configure):
   sub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1
